Off the coast of Jamaica, researchers are discovering that sound itself can be an act of ecological repair — that by broadcasting the acoustic signature of a living reef into waters long grown silent, they can coax life back toward places it had abandoned. The experiment rests on a quiet truth about how organisms navigate the world: larvae do not drift blindly, but listen for signs of belonging. In a time when the tools of conservation have often felt inadequate to the scale of loss, this approach offers something rare — a method that works with nature's own logic rather than around it.
